How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Social Sciences from Coppin Cost?

$6,716 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Coppin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Coppin paid an average of $615 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$197 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$4,648 $11,045
Fees $2,068 $2,068
Books and Supplies $800 $800
On Campus Room and Board $10,655 $10,655
On Campus Other Expenses $3,386 $3,386

Coppin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Social Sciences

9 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
66.7% Women
88.9%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 9 bachelor’s degrees in social sciences hand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 66.7% of the social sciences students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 54.0%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 88.9% of social sciences bachelor’s degree recipients at Coppin in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 39%.
